Get to know Jeanine Spence!

Jeanine Spence works the body, on and off the bicycle.

The racers on the team were given 15 interview questions ranging from serious to silly. They are free to choice which ones they wanted to answer:

Have you stopped and done any good deeds as a cyclist?

I have helped "bonking" cyclists - gave them water and energy gels, helped a novice learn to change a tire, and stopped to call for a stranded motorist.

If there is a 4-inch long plain brown snail crawling in your bicycle path, do you...steer around it? worry about slipping on the goo? stop to look at it and maybe take pictures? put it in jersey pocket as a pet? or move it to a safer place? (any other answers are fine)

When riding across the country on a PAC tour, I stopped for an eight inch diameter turtle. I nervously picked it up and carried it to the side of the road. Also, was able to rescue a domestic rabbit and find a home for it on a local ride.

What is your opinion of painted bike lanes in some cities?

Love bike lanes... wish there were more.

What do you usually tell (or want to tell) the bad-tempered drivers yelling at you to ride on the sidewalk?

I wonder how big their 'behinds' are...

If you were able to ride on any type of surface, anywhere on the earth, where would you love to ride? Why?

My favorite place to ride is on pavement, anywhere the sun is shining, with friends.

What is the shortest distance you ever rode before feeling as tired as you expect to feel at end of RAAM? Why?

The first time I rode the Terrible Two..... It was my second double century and I was totally unprepared for how hot, cold, steep and long the ride turned out to be.

Is there any kind of cycling part, material, or equipment that is not on the market that you dream of being available?

Airbags that inflate just before you hit the pavement!

If any animals will surely be easy to transport, care, and even help with the crewing, what kind of animal will you like as a member of the crew team? Why?

A Labrador Retriever - They are always happy, energetic and enthusiastic.

What kind of "party" will you like at RAAM's finish line?

Anything that includes beer and RAAM finishers!
